Transaction ef60dc33beee7073f35aba188616ea25e87a0c70f96ef46ae917972cc09cbe16
1 Input
2 Outputs
- ef60dc33beee7073f35aba188616ea25e87a0c70f96ef46ae917972cc09cbe16:0
- ef60dc33beee7073f35aba188616ea25e87a0c70f96ef46ae917972cc09cbe16:1
value 29070578
address 3LznohDLXfJaNLekWoQRpyHPsL8T5WtkuB
value 30356110
address 1FCGDqsyDLJ3CL41Jnj5SdtV2sYbmr9sS3